What is the past tense of retake?
retook
Word forms: plural, 3rd person singular present tense retakes, present participle retaking , past tense retook , past participle retaken pronunciation note: The verb is pronounced (riːteɪk ).
What is to redo something?
1 : to do over or again. 2 : redecorate.
1. To do over again. 2. To redecorate: redo the walls in red. An act or instance of doing something again. American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, Fifth Edition.
